General-duty citation text
29 CFR 1910.106(e)(6)(ii): The employer did not ensure that Category 1 or 2 flammable liquids, or Category 3 flammable liquids with a flashpoint below 100 degrees F (37.8 degrees C), were not dispensed into containers unless the nozzle and container are electrically interconnected: (a)Prairie Technology, LLC at 47183 Winter Place, Sioux Falls, SD 57107: On or about and at times prior to to March 8, 2018, the employer did not ensure employees were protected from fire hazards in that a 55-gallon drum of acetone, a category 2 flammable liquid, located in the hand cutting area was appropriately grounded/bonded to secondary containers as the grounding/bonding wire was damaged and not in use. This condition exposed employees to fire hazards. (b)Prairie Technology, LLC at 47183 Winter Place, Sioux Falls, SD 57107: On or about and at times prior to March 23, 2018, the employer did not ensure employees were protected from fire hazards in that a 55-gallon drum of acetone, a category 2 flammable liquid, located in the hand cutting area on the exterior wall of the spray booth was appropriately bonded to secondary containers as the grounding wire was connected to the ground in the electrical box for the spray booth ventilation system and lights; however no bonding wire was provided to connect the container to which acetone was being dispensed. This condition exposed employees to fire and electrical hazards.

General-duty citation text
29 CFR 1910.107(m)(1): The employer did not ensure that all spraying operations involving the use of organic peroxides and other dual component coatings were conducted in approved sprinklered spray booths meeting the requirements of this section: (a)Prairie Technology, LLC at 47183 Winter Place, Sioux Falls, SD 57107: On or about and at times prior to March 23, 2018, the employer did not ensure that employees were protected from chemical and fire hazards in that employees performed gel coat application using a methyl ethyl ketone peroxide, an organic peroxide, containing catalyst in a non-sprinklered spray booth. This condition exposed employees to chemical and fire hazards.

General-duty citation text
29 CFR 1910.133(a)(1): The employer did not ensure that each affected employee uses appropriate eye or face protection when exposed to eye or face hazards from liquid chemicals, acids or caustic liquids: (a) Prairie Technology, LLC at 47183 Winter Place, Sioux Falls, SD 57107: On or about and at times prior to March 8, 2018, the employer did not ensure an employees were protected from eye hazards in that that an employee disassembling the gun of the FIT-CMB-PAT-7-SP MVP system suffered a chemical exposure in their eye due to the employee not wearing appropriate eye protection during this process.This condition exposed employees to chemical hazards and lead to an employee injury requiring medical treatment. (b) Prairie Technology, LLC at 47183 Winter Place, Sioux Falls, SD 57107: On or about and at times prior to March 8, 2018, the employer did not ensure employees were protected eye hazards in that the employer did not ensure each employee performing work in the fiberglass spray lay-up area wore adequate eye protection. This condition exposed employees to chemical hazards.
